Dear Esteemed Colleagues,
It is our distinct honor and pleasure to invite you to the 16th Croatian Congress on Epilepsy, which will take place in
Zagreb from April 20 to 22, 2026, at the Hotel Aristos.
The main topics of this year’s congress are:
- Pharmacotherapy of epilepsies
- Non-pharmacological approaches to the treatment of epilepsies
- Comorbidities and psychosocial aspects in the management of epilepsies
- Status epilepticus
- Epilepsies in rare diseases and epileptic encephalopathies
- Self-limited epilepsies and withdrawal of antiseizure medications
- Terminology in epileptology
- Nonepileptic seizures
- Round table: The future of epileptology and artificial intelligence in the monitoring and treatment of patients
- Interpretation of EEG recordings – interactive workshop
- Free topics
We are proud that, at this year’s congress, neurophysiology technologists will also have the opportunity to present their work within a dedicated section.

Guidelines for Writing Abstracts
- Abstracts must be submitted in both Croatian and English (foreign participants submit the abstract in English only).
- Names and surnames of authors/co-authors, affiliations, and the title are not included in the word count of the abstract.
- Write the name of the presenting author in CAPITAL LETTERS.
- Write authors’ and co-authors’ names without academic titles.
- State the official name and address of the institution(s) of the author(s) and co-author(s) in English.
- Numerically link the author(s) and the institution(s).
- Provide the e-mail address of the first author.
- Abstracts will not be proofread. Authors are responsible for linguistic and content accuracy.
- Maximum length: 350 words in Croatian and 400 words in English. At the end, include key words (max 3) relevant to the work.
- Abstract structure: 1) introduction, 2) methods, results / case presentation, 3) conclusion.
